Color #dccefc
A vivid, highly saturated very light blue.
Conversions
#dccefc
rgb(220, 206, 252)
hsl(258.3, 88.5%, 89.8%)
hsv(258.3, 18.3%, 98.8%)
cmyk(12.7%, 18.3%, 0%, 1.2%)
lab(85.19, 13.53, -20.74)
lch(85.19, 24.76, 303.12)
oklch(87.8%, 0.0644, 298.99)
hwb(258.3, 80.8%, 1.2%)

Accessibility
Black text reads better on this background (14.28:1). That passes WCAG AAA (≥7:1) for normal-size text.
